Savor the irresistible flavors of these Garlic Herb Chicken Drumsticks—a simple yet elegant dish that's perfect for weeknight dinners or casual gatherings. Juicy drumsticks are marinated in a fragrant blend of fresh garlic, parsley, thyme, zesty lemon juice, and a hint of sweet honey, then roasted to golden perfection in just 40 minutes. A touch of smoky paprika and a drizzle of olive oil enhance the savory richness, making every bite a mouthwatering experience. With minimal prep time and a marinade that can be made in advance, this easy chicken drumstick recipe is perfect for busy cooks looking to bring bold, herbaceous flavors to the table. Serve these herby, oven-baked drumsticks alongside mashed potatoes, roasted vegetables, or a crisp green salad for a wholesome, crowd-pleasing meal.

🥘 Ingredients

10 items
  • 8 pieces chicken drumsticks
  • 6 cloves garlic cloves
  • 3 tablespoons fresh parsley
  • 1 tablespoon fresh thyme
  • 4 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ons lemon juice
  • 1 tablespoon honey
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on black pepper

📝 Instructions

10 steps
1

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with aluminum foil or parchment paper for easy cleanup.

2

Finely mince the garlic cloves and chop the fresh parsley and thyme.

3

In a medium mixing bowl, combine the minced garlic, parsley, thyme, olive oil, lemon juice, honey, paprika, salt, and black pepper. Stir until well mixed.

4

Rinse and pat dry the chicken drumsticks with paper towels. Place them in a large mixing bowl or a resealable plastic bag.

5

Pour the garlic herb marinade over the drumsticks, ensuring each piece is evenly coated. Let the chicken marinate for at least 30 minutes, or cover and refrigerate for up to 8 hours for more intense flavor.

6

Place the marinated drumsticks on the prepared baking sheet, leaving space between each piece for even cooking.

7

Bake in the preheated oven for 40 minutes, flipping the drumsticks halfway through cooking to ensure both sides are golden brown.

8

To check for doneness, use a meat thermometer inserted into the thickest part of the drumstick without touching the bone. The internal temperature should read 165°F (74°C).

9

Remove the drumsticks from the oven and let them rest for 5 minutes before serving.

10

Serve warm with a side of mashed potatoes, steamed vegetables, or a fresh garden salad.
